$130,000 after tax in Virginia
On a $130,000 salary in Virginia, a single filer takes home about $92,904 a year — $7,742 a month, or $3,573 per biweekly paycheck.
Breakdown2026
Gross salary$130,000
Federal income tax−$19,934
Social Security−$8,060
Medicare−$1,885
Virginia state tax−$7,218
Take-home pay$92,904
Monthly$7,742
Biweekly$3,573
Effective rate28.5%
Same salary in Alaska +$7,218 more a year — Virginia state tax costs you $7,218 annually
Married filing jointly
The same $130,000 salary filing jointly gives roughly $101,598 a year ($8,466 a month) — $8,694 more than filing single, because the brackets and standard deduction are wider.
Common questions
How much is $130,000 after taxes in Virginia?
About $92,904 a year as a single filer — roughly $7,742 per month or $3,573 per biweekly paycheck, after federal income tax, Social Security, Medicare and Virginia state tax.
How much federal tax do I pay on $130,000?
Approximately $19,934 in federal income tax, plus $9,945 in FICA (Social Security and Medicare). Your top federal bracket is 24%.
What is the effective tax rate on $130,000 in Virginia?
About 28.5% of gross pay once federal tax, FICA and state tax are combined.
